Abstract
The utility model discloses a kind of heating system of reactor, including reactor and heat-conducting oil furnace, chuck is provided with outside reactor, the chuck top of reactor opens up oil outlet, chuck bottom opens up fuel feed hole, heat-conducting oil furnace top has oil inlet, heat-conducting oil furnace bottom has oil-out, oil-out is connected with gear pump, gear pump is driven by motor, also include condenser, fuel feed hole is connected by the output end of oil pipe and gear pump, oil outlet is connected by the oil inlet of oil pipe and heat-conducting oil furnace, condenser forms circulation loop by pipeline and reactor, cooling duct is additionally provided with outside the oil groove of heat-conducting oil furnace, distinguish external running water water pipe and outlet pipe in cooling duct both ends.The heating system of the reactor can also can quickly cool down conduction oil with reuse water vapour.
